Casey Hayward

For the Atlanta Falcons of the National Football League, Casey Hayward Jr. plays cornerback in American football. He is 1.80 m tall and 87 kg in weight. He was a three-sport star in football, basketball, and track while he was a student at Perry High School. He attended Vanderbilt University after high school, where he played college football for the Vanderbilt Commodores from 2008 to 2011.

He started playing during his first year and switched to cornerback permanently. He tied the school record most interceptions (15) in his final year as a Vanderbilt Commodore. In addition, he recorded 62 tackles and seven interceptions, which ranks third among all Vanderbilt players in a single season. Sports Illustrated selected him an All-American for the middle of the season.

He was the first Vanderbilt All-American in four years when, at the conclusion of the season, he was selected to the second team by the Walter Camp Foundation. In the second round of the 2012 NFL Draft, the Green Bay Packers selected Hayward. Against the San Francisco 49ers in the Green Bay Packers’ season opener, he played in his first regular-season game as a professional.

His three-year deal with the San Diego Chargers was finalized in March 2016. For his efforts in 2020’s opening week, he was named the AFC Defensive Player of the Week. The Chargers released him in March 2021. On May 4, 2021, he committed to the Las Vegas Raiders. He committed to the Atlanta Falcons in March 2022 to a two-year, $11 million deal.

How Much Does Casey Hayward Make?

Casey Hayward makes an annual salary of $5.5 million per his contract with the Falcons.
